原文:字符串拷贝方法以及存在陷阱

文章目录 前言 拷贝方式 内存拷贝memcpy 函数原型 例子: 陷阱 结果 解决方案 字符串拷贝strcpy 函数原型 例子 说明 string方法拷贝string::copy 原型 例子 陷阱 amp 结果 解决方案 后语 前言 在实际项目开发中,字符串拷贝是个很常见用法。方式有很多种,在我们使用过程中,一般不会出现什么问题,或者说是一般编译器不会编译报错,甚至运行报错。但一些潜在的陷阱是经 ...

2019-06-03 16:06 0 606 推荐指数:

查看详情

JavaScript字符串转数字的5种方法及其陷阱

摘要 :JavaScript 是一个神奇的语言,字符串转数字有 5 种方法,各有各的坑法! String 转换为 Number 有很多种方式,我可以想到的有 5 种! 选择哪一种呢?什么时候选择它?为什么选择这种它?我们逐一进行分析,并解析每种方式的常见陷阱。 parseInt ...

Thu Apr 04 18:14:00 CST 2019 0 6336
汇编字符串拷贝

以上代码参考http://blog.csdn.net/u013507368/article/details/40859081。 汇编传送指令参考http://www.doc88.com ...

Tue Nov 07 19:26:00 CST 2017 0 1034
C语言字符串拷贝

C语言里定义一个字符串可以使用指针也可以使用数组,如:(1) char *s="hello"; //"hello"是字符串常量,s是指向常量的指针,常量是不允许改变的,不能写成s[0]=X,但可以改变指针的值,使其指向不同的常量,如 s = "Xeron";(2) char s[]="hello ...

Mon Oct 15 23:43:00 CST 2012 0 10877
C++ 函数中返回字符串的一个陷阱

可能第一眼看上去没什么毛病,BUT getname()里面的get_name是一个字符串数组。在函数return之后这个get_name会释放内存(因为她在栈中,函数执行玩会弹栈)。所以main函数中的name变成了一个野指针,这是一个很危险的操作。 解决办法:返回一个在堆中 ...

Sun Dec 17 17:45:00 CST 2017 0 8082
字符串方法

。. 三,字符串操作方法:concat() slice() substr() substrin ...

Sun Jun 23 02:39:00 CST 2019 1 2370
如何字符串拷贝函数的几种方法,你猜哪个效率最高?

strcpy,即string copy(字符串复制)的缩写。 是C语言标准库中实现字符串拷贝的一个函数。 各大公司笔试题最喜欢考的一道题,快来看看,你会几种方法? 问:你会如何实现这个函数呢? 1 2 3 4 5 汇编 ...

Fri Apr 23 02:27:00 CST 2021 0 236
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M